Hi Wolfy,
Very nice (I'm a machinist, so I appreciate things that are well-done).
I would add an anti-rotation screw on the bottom that could mate with any slot that might be on the tripod head.
Majestic and other large tripod heads have such a slot, allowing the retaining screw to move back and forth.
This hex-drive screw from McMaster-Carr has a 3/8" diameter smooth side that won't damage the tripod head:
https://www.mcmaster.com/90332a131
The particular item linked has a 1/4"-20 male thread, and is 1/2" long.
Other thread sizes and head diameters are available. The thread size varies with the head diameter.
